From DallasE: Star Wars Legion Imperial Troops (49 points)

Scrambling a bit for something to submit this week... I pulled a squad of Legion 3D prints out of a box. I've had these for a few years, but hadn't yet gotten paint on them. I think it's because they're slightly larger than the rest of the models I'd painted for Star Wars Hoth/winter gaming. In any event as long as they're segregated in their own unit they should be fine.

I had a bit of deciding to do on the colours. Black uniforms would've made sense, but then how do you contrast the belts and holsters? White didn't make sense. So they got grey uniforms and black belts and holsters.

Of course most of 'em also have these funky backpacks and chest armour. Internet sleuthing found these to be snowtrooper stuff, so they were painted white. I could see these guys as a squad of special-ops guys outfitted with some snowtrooper gear for a Hoth mission.

The Imperial insignia was a challenge to paint and on these models is pretty... "impressionistic." Oh well.

The helmets and goggle lenses got a coat of gloss varnish as well.

So these guys are done, back to some historical 15mm or 28mm vehicles next week I think.
